Subject: Re: [PATCH 2/4] samples/bpf: Use llc in PATH, rather than a hardcoded value

On 3/31/16 4:25 AM, Naveen N. Rao wrote:
> While at it, fix some typos in the comment.

> diff --git a/samples/bpf/Makefile b/samples/bpf/Makefile
> index 502c9fc..88bc5a0 100644
> --- a/samples/bpf/Makefile
> +++ b/samples/bpf/Makefile
> @@ -76,16 +76,13 @@ HOSTLOADLIBES_offwaketime += -lelf
> HOSTLOADLIBES_spintest += -lelf
> HOSTLOADLIBES_map_perf_test += -lelf -lrt
>
> -# point this to your LLVM backend with bpf support
> -LLC=$(srctree)/tools/bpf/llvm/bld/Debug+Asserts/bin/llc
> -
> -# asm/sysreg.h inline assmbly used by it is incompatible with llvm.
> -# But, ehere is not easy way to fix it, so just exclude it since it is
> +# asm/sysreg.h - inline assembly used by it is incompatible with llvm.
> +# But, there is no easy way to fix it, so just exclude it since it is
> # useless for BPF samples.
> $(obj)/%.o: $(src)/%.c
> clang $(NOSTDINC_FLAGS) $(LINUXINCLUDE) $(EXTRA_CFLAGS) \
> -D__KERNEL__ -D__ASM_SYSREG_H -Wno-unused-value -Wno-pointer-sign \
> - -O2 -emit-llvm -c $< -o -| $(LLC) -march=bpf -filetype=obj -o $@
> + -O2 -emit-llvm -c $< -o -| llc -march=bpf -filetype=obj -o $@
> clang $(NOSTDINC_FLAGS) $(LINUXINCLUDE) $(EXTRA_CFLAGS) \
> -D__KERNEL__ -D__ASM_SYSREG_H -Wno-unused-value -Wno-pointer-sign \
> - -O2 -emit-llvm -c $< -o -| $(LLC) -march=bpf -filetype=asm -o $@.s
> + -O2 -emit-llvm -c $< -o -| llc -march=bpf -filetype=asm -o $@.s
that was a workaround when clang/llvm didn't have bpf support.
Now clang 3.7 and 3.8 have bpf built-in, so make sense to remove
manual calls to llc completely.
Just use 'clang -target bpf -O2 -D... -c $< -o $@'
